So we are in the midst of orientation right now, I haven't really had a sense of time since I have been here, but looking at my computer it is Wednesday, so I have two more days of orientation before classes begin. Orientation is a little bit more work than I expected, but today was so much fun, because we went on a tour of the Universite de Nantes. It is so different than Southwestern, or really any University in the states because in France college is free so the colleges are not in the best of shape, they are pretty old and dirty. We learned though that at the university we can eat a complete meal for only 2E85 which is probably the cheapest thing we have yet to find here, besides the SOLDE (sale). The food wasn't even bad, we got dessert, bread, main course, and fruit or vegetable. We are supposed to speak French while we are there, but today we were speaking Franglais and it is was obvious we were Americans because we were so loud and confused about everything. But it was a lot of fun!
